Smriti Mandhana climbs to top of ICC ODI women’s rankings

Image: The Economic Times

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

THE JHARKHAND STORY DESK

 

Dubai, June 17: Smriti Mandhana has reclaimed the No. 1 spot in the ICC Women’s ODI batting rankings, marking her return to the top for the first time since 2019.

The Indian vice-captain surged ahead after South Africa’s Laura Wolvaardt dropped 19 rating points, allowing Mandhana to climb with a total of 727 points.

England skipper Natalie Sciver-Brunt is close behind with 719 points, the same as Wolvaardt, who now occupies the third position due to decimal differences.

Mandhana’s rise comes on the back of her exceptional form, including a commanding century in the final of the recent tri-series in Colombo featuring Sri Lanka and South Africa — her 11th in ODI cricket.

This return to the top ends a six-year gap since Mandhana last led the rankings. She has consistently featured in the top 10 over the past few years but hadn’t reached No. 1 since early 2019.

Other Indian batters on the list include Jemimah Rodrigues and captain Harmanpreet Kaur, ranked 14th and 15th respectively. Mandhana also holds the fourth spot in the ICC T20I batting rankings.

India will soon face England in a series comprising five T20Is and three ODIs later this month, offering more opportunities for the rankings to shift.
